What is the magnitude (in radian) of the interior angle of a regular pentagon?

  1. A. \frac{\pi}{5}
  2. B. \frac{2\pi}{5}
  3. C. \frac{3\pi}{5}
  4. D. \frac{4\pi}{5}

Correct Answer: C. \frac{3\pi}{5}

Explanation

The formula for the interior angle of a regular n-gon is \frac{(n-2)\pi}{n} radians. For a pentagon, n=5, so the interior angle is \frac{(5-2)\pi}{5} = \frac{3\pi}{5} radians.
